Though WCAS is not a research oriented Higher Educational Institution, still it endeavors to pursue some of its research activities for its researchers. To accomplish this, a new Research and Development Cell was started in the year 2015. The main aim of the Research & Development Cell is to facilitate researcher for conducting research. This includes providing encouragement to the researcher so that quality research can be conducted. The faculty members not possessing Doctorate Degree are encouraged to complete their PhD. Research scholars are advised to submit good research projects to “The Research Council” (TRC) of Oman in order to get funds for their research. WCAS Research and Development Cell supports research collaboration with other HEIs in and outside Oman. WCAS also provides support to its faculties by providing seed capital money for conducting internal projects.

WCAS also has mechanism to support to its faculties for possible collaborative research work with the parent university (BIT, Mesra). Sponsorship for conducting International Conclave

Omani Rial 10,000.000 was granted by The Research Council (TRC) Oman for conducting International Conclave on Innovations in Engineering and Management (ICIEM) in Feb 2016. Participants from eleven countries presented sixty eight research papers in sixteen different sessions.
